修复模型推理

This commit is contained in:
limin 2025-01-24 10:07:40 +08:00
parent 7d478f8924
commit 7824bf7987
5 changed files with 10 additions and 4 deletions

View File

@ -201,8 +201,12 @@ public class ConversationServiceImpl implements ConversationService {
}
ChatRespVO chatRespVO = BeanUtils.toBean(chatReqVO, ChatRespVO.class);
chatRespVO.setResponse(modelCompletionsRespVO.getAnswer());
// 将聊天记录放入缓存
// 将聊天记录放入缓存 先注释 TODO
stringRedisTemplate.opsForList().rightPush(CHAT_HIStORY_REDIS_KEY + ":" + chatReqVO.getUuid(), JsonUtils.toJsonString(message));
ModelCompletionsReqVO.ModelCompletionsMessage responseMessage = new ModelCompletionsReqVO.ModelCompletionsMessage();
responseMessage.setRole("assistant");
responseMessage.setContent(modelCompletionsRespVO.getAnswer());
stringRedisTemplate.opsForList().rightPush(CHAT_HIStORY_REDIS_KEY + ":" + chatReqVO.getUuid(), JsonUtils.toJsonString(responseMessage));
DataRefluxDataSaveReqVO dataRefluxDataSaveReqVO = new DataRefluxDataSaveReqVO();
dataRefluxDataSaveReqVO.setModelServiceId(chatReqVO.getModelId());
dataRefluxDataSaveReqVO.setModelType(chatReqVO.getModelType());

View File

@ -26,6 +26,7 @@ public class ChatCompletion {
private int index;
private Message message;
private String finish_reason;
private String logprobs;
}
@Data
@ -34,6 +35,7 @@ public class ChatCompletion {
public static class Message {
private String role;
private String content;
private String tool_calls;
}
@Data

View File

@ -260,7 +260,7 @@ llm:
# 基础模型列表 GET
base_model_list: http://36.103.199.104:9997/model/v1/models
# 模型对话 POST
model_completions: http://36.103.199.104:9997/model/v1/chat/completions
model_completions: http://36.103.199.104:9997/v1/chat/completions
# aigc表数据查询接口
table_data_query: http://36.103.199.104:5123/table/%s
# aigc模型推理

View File

@ -300,7 +300,7 @@ llm:
# 模型列表 GET
base_model_list: http://36.103.199.104:9997/model/v1/models
# 模型对话 POST
model_completions: http://36.103.199.104:9997/model/v1/chat/completions
model_completions: http://36.103.199.104:9997/v1/chat/completions
# aigc表数据查询接口
table_data_query: http://36.103.199.104:5123/table/%s
# aigc模型推理

View File

@ -300,7 +300,7 @@ llm:
# 模型列表 GET
base_model_list: http://36.103.199.104:9997/model/v1/models
# 模型对话 POST
model_completions: http://36.103.199.104:9997/model/v1/chat/completions
model_completions: http://36.103.199.104:9997/v1/chat/completions
# aigc表数据查询接口
table_data_query: http://36.133.1.230:5123/table/%s
# aigc模型推理